Why Angel Investing Feels Overwhelming

If you’ve ever made an angel investment, you know this part.

Deal memo.
Pitch deck.
Founder video.
Q&A thread.
Investor POV.
Term sheet.
SPV docs.

Every deal structure is different:

  • Convertible notes
  • Priced rounds
  • Revenue or dividend hybrids
  • SAFEs
  • Cap tables that make your eyes cross

Angel investing isn’t hard because founders aren’t interesting.

It’s hard because information is fragmented.

You’re stitching together context manually every time.

And most angels are doing this at 10pm after their day job.
